                          So I was able to update winkfp and ncs with v69 datens that I knew contained both the DCT files (gts/updated u.s.) and the engine file I wan (240E/241E whichever one) with the BMW coding tool.

                          I decided to go straight to the ...69 updated u.s. file based on what people, including kaiv, have reported. My issue was never with shifting speed (how could it be, all settings and software are in the milliseconds), it was with its clunkiness or slowness to get into 1st or the lurching it would do in 1st I think when the clutch was finally fully engaged.

                          Click image for larger version  Name:	20250312_113216.jpg Views:	0 Size:	69.7 KB ID:	297732

                          It worked flawlessly. And I'm very happy to report that it gets into 1st after backing up very quickly now, no lag. There's no drop in RPM and forward momentum when leaving the line in 1st, and the tranny has retained its noises and some clunkiness which I do actually like - I'm always after the feels and noises, don't want it too smooth and perfect. But I do have a small issue. Kevin, can you confirm this behavior:

                          The car is way more sensative to not being on flat ground or something. It will throw itself into neutral when I take my foot of the brake, and I don't remember it doing that before so much. Only if I had the door open maybe, it would throw itself into neutral and give that message about not being in "P".

                          Which I think is a stupid message - you can't even get into P anyway. The only way the car gets into P is when you turn it off AND remove key fob.



                          So I'm in a parking spot, in what I would say is fairly flat ground, and what's happening is that the car is running and it will not stay and sit in R or 1st. It will throw itself into neutral and give a warning. So let's say I want to back up. I put it into R (my foot is on brake pedal), then I take my foot off brake pedal and go to put it onto throttle and start to back up, but I can't becuase it's popped back into N.

                          So get this: I had to keep my left foot on the brake, and use my right foot to start to accelerate, then take my left foot off brake. That worked, it stayed in R, and I was able to back up. After turning the car off and restarting later, it wasn't exhibiting this behavior. But then on

                          a later drive, it did it to me again. I seemed to notice that it exhiited this behavior more often or more quickly when not on level ground, but it did still do it to me on level ground.

                          If I can't figure this out or if it bothers me enough, I might be forced into the GTS tune I guess. Maybe I can figure out how to code the module's behavior?

                          Edit: I did some testing with the seatbelt on/off. it definitely does it constantly if the seat belt is not engaged, so that makes some sense. But it is still doing it at times even with the belt buckled.

                          Also, even when it is acting "normal" and staying in gear, it's still making a GONG sound every single time I go to neutral. I understand a warning being a good idea of the door opens, like the driver is running back to the house, adn you don't want the car rolling away, but if all I'm doing is backing up (door closed, seatbelt on), WHY is it making a sound at me when I go to N then to 1st. So every time I move through N to get to reverse or D/1, it's gonna beep at me? So annoying.

                              Tyler: can't say I recall any changes in regards to that behavior on my personal car.
                              Maybe try doing a full relearn/readapt of the transmission. Dunno if it would have any effect on that but I do it on every car when flashing (for good measure) and no one has come back with any complaint.
